What you will do The core of this role is organization and accuracy. You will support the day-to-day administrative needs of our consulting team as they configure systems and build new reporting frameworks. Your tasks will focus on making sure the project moves toward a successful handover without losing track of important details.
- Maintain project schedules and update task lists to ensure every milestone is met on time.
- Assist in the creation and maintenance of project documentation that client teams can actually use.
- Schedule internal and client meetings, preparing agendas and taking precise notes to record decisions.
- Coordinate the collection of data requirements and system specifications from various departments.
- Organize project files and shared folders to ensure a single source of truth for all records.
- Track budget usage and report on progress according to our fixed-price agreements.
- Support the quality control process by checking project deliverables for consistent formatting and clarity.
- Help prepare training and configuration guides that will eventually be handed over to the client.
